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Greensboro to Haw River is to drive which costs $4 - $7 and takes 32 min.
The fastest way to get from Greensboro to Haw River is to train and taxi which takes 29 min and costs $19 - $30.
No, there is no direct bus from Greensboro to Haw River. However, there are services departing from Greensboro Depot and arriving at Alamance Community College via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 55 min.
The distance between Greensboro and Haw River is 26 miles. The road distance is 25.7 miles.
The best way to get from Greensboro to Haw River without a car is to train and taxi which takes 29 min and costs $19 - $30.
It takes approximately 29 min to get from Greensboro to Haw River, including transfers.
Greensboro to Haw River bus services, operated by PART NC, depart from Greensboro Depot station.
Greensboro to Haw River bus services, operated by PART NC, arrive at Alamance Community College station.
Yes, the driving distance between Greensboro to Haw River is 26 miles. It takes approximately 32 min to drive from Greensboro to Haw River.

What companies run services between Greensboro, NC, USA and Haw River, NC, USA?
PART NC operates a bus from Greensboro Depot to Alamance Community College 4 times a day.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 49 min.
